Moving Tips
Clean Out the Fridge
Have you taken care of your refrigerator? Remember, you need to empty, defrost, and clean it out before the movers can load it. We recommend that you unplug your refrigerator and freezer at least 24 hours in advance before loading day. Leave the doors open so that they may come up to room temperature and air dry.
Moving Your Computer Tower
The desktop’s CPU tower should never be packed on its side; rather it should be loaded upright. Placing the motherboard on its side may potentially loosen the interior cards during the move.

Packing Your Lamp Shadees
Your lamp shades should be packed in a separate box from your lamps. Avoid using newspaper as stuffing material as the ink may cause stains on your shades. Use clean packing paper or bubble wrap to protect your lamp shades' linings. Try stacking your lamp shades into a single, large carton with packing material between each.
